Why support your local club

Many clubs operate at a loss

According to FIFA’s Benchmarking Report from 2021, 70% of women’s football clubs operate at a loss.

Most support is by busy volunteers

Clubs are often supported by volunteers and parents who are short on time.

Managing club finances can be a pain

Managing club admin and finances is a key pain point. More time on the books can mean less time on the field.

Connecting with a local club

Plan and prepare first

Have a clear idea of what you’re offering and what you’re seeking before you make an approach.

Talk to your team

Ask if anyone is already involved in a local club. If not, consider if you want to make an impact in your immediate area or somewhere new.

Think about anything you'd like

Perhaps it’s your logo on the front of shirts, signage at the club house or around the ground, or placement in club newsletters.

Use social media to make contact

Often clubs have social media pages, which can provide a direct way to start a conversation. Or do a search to find contact details.
